The Postal Automation System Market: Transforming Global Mail in the Age of Digitization


 

The Postal Automation System Market is undergoing a quiet but significant transformation. As of 2023, the market stood at a value of USD 876.46 million, and by 2024, it is projected to grow to USD 921.74 million. Looking ahead, the market is expected to reach over USD 1,500.00 million by 2031, expanding at a compound annual growth rate (CAGR) of 6.9% from 2024 to 2031.

This growth illustrates a strong, sustained investment in mail-handling technologies, driven by global e-commerce expansion, increasing parcel volumes, and the need for cost-efficient, error-free postal operations. It signals not only the relevance of automated systems but also their role as foundational infrastructure for national and international logistics in the digital age.

Market Evolution & Significance

Historically, mail sorting and delivery were manual, time-consuming processes prone to errors and inefficiencies. However, the last decade has brought about a paradigm shift. The rise in cross-border e-commerce, last-mile delivery innovations, and smart city initiatives have pushed postal services to modernize their infrastructure.

Now, automated postal systems are embedded with technologies like OCR (Optical Character Recognition), barcode scanning, RFID, and AI-enhanced sorting algorithms. These systems can process millions of mail pieces per day, reduce error margins, and allow for scalable operations that adapt to seasonal or surge-based volumes.

Moreover, governments and private carriers are increasingly integrating postal automation into national infrastructure development plans, especially in emerging markets where demand for fast, reliable postal service is rising in tandem with digital commerce adoption.

Recent Developments & Future Outlook

The market is being reshaped by continuous innovation and strategic pivots:

  • AI Integration: Smart routing algorithms and machine learning systems are improving mail and parcel flow through facilities.

  • IoT and Real-Time Tracking: RFID and connected devices now provide real-time visibility across the logistics chain.

  • Sustainable Automation: Systems are being redesigned to reduce energy consumption and carbon footprint, aligning with global ESG standards.

  • Hybrid Mail Centers: Many postal centers are transforming into multifunctional logistics hubs, combining parcel lockers, last-mile delivery zones, and digital kiosks.

Looking ahead, expect the market to see a surge in cloud-based automation platforms, predictive maintenance using digital twins, and smart distribution networks powered by 5G and edge computing. These will enhance delivery precision and reduce operational downtime significantly.


Regional Analysis of Postal Automation System Market

North America

With high e-commerce penetration and established logistics infrastructure, North America remains a mature and tech-forward market. USPS and other regional players have long embraced OCR and barcode systems, now exploring cloud and AI integration for next-gen solutions.

Asia Pacific

The fastest-growing region, thanks to rising urbanization, government-led digital transformation efforts, and a booming e-commerce sector. Countries like China, India, and Japan are investing heavily in automation for both national postal services and private carriers.

Europe

Known for its early adoption of RFID and sustainability-driven innovation. European markets prioritize system standardization and environmentally efficient operations, with growing investments in AI-driven postal software.

Latin America & Middle East & Africa

These regions are emerging as opportunity zones. Growing middle classes, expanding e-commerce networks, and government digitization programs are fueling interest in scalable, cost-efficient postal automation solutions. The focus here is on retrofitting legacy systems with modular automation units.
